Potential double injury boost for West Ham ahead of trip to north London

West Ham United is gearing up for an important match against Tottenham Hotspur this weekend. They have received good news as reports suggest that two key players for Spurs, Richarlison and Son Heung-min, might miss the game due to injuries. This situation presents a significant opportunity for West Ham as they prepare for this London derby.

West Ham recently enjoyed a strong performance, defeating Ipswich Town 4-1 before the international break. This victory has boosted their confidence as they head into the match against Spurs. The Hammers are looking to build on this momentum and capitalize on Tottenham’s recent struggles. Spurs faced a disappointing loss against Brighton, where they squandered a 2-0 lead to end up losing 3-2. This result has put pressure on Tottenham and their manager, Ange Postecoglou.

Tottenham’s star players, Son and Richarlison, have been instrumental in their attacking lineup. Son has been particularly effective this season, contributing four goals in the first five matches. He has developed a strong partnership with new signing Dominic Solanke, making their attack quite formidable. Richarlison, on the other hand, has had a challenging season due to injuries, playing only 25 minutes so far. However, he was an important player for Spurs last season, scoring 11 goals and providing four assists.

If both Son and Richarlison are unavailable, Spurs will face a significant lack of attacking options. Their absence could hinder Tottenham’s ability to score and apply pressure on West Ham’s defense. This scenario could give West Ham an edge as they aim for a positive result in North London.

The last time West Ham faced Spurs in the Premier League, they achieved a remarkable comeback. Cristian Romero scored first for Spurs, but West Ham responded with a goal from Jarrod Bowen, followed by a late winner from James Ward-Prowse.
